The Reserve Organization of America (ROA) is America’s only congressionally chartered advocate dedicated exclusively to community advocacy for the Reserve and National Guard services. The ROA fully supports reserve communities, veterans, and their families, ensuring these forces remain prepared to serve the nation. Membership is available to all ranks within the uniformed services, including both enlisted personnel and officers.
The Department of Northwest serves All members of the Reserve and National Guard from all seven service branches. The department serves these personnel in the states of Alaska, Idaho, Oregon, Washington and Wyoming, and those that maintain their ROA membership with our department but live outside our five state area. Our department roster represents over 1700 members of the Reserve and National Guard forces. For more information about who we are and what we do, please visit the departments group pages.
